Venue
The venue’s main event space (The Meeting Room at Judson Church) features a spacious 46’7” x 49’4” wood dance floor, with a maximum room occupancy of 300 people. The audience seating will be configured with rows of chairs on three sides with the majority of seating at the front (“downstage”).
The facility is ADA accessible, including elevator access to the third floor and accessible restroom facilities. Amenities include one drinking fountain, two multi-stall unisex restrooms, and two ADA-accessible bathrooms.
The venue also includes a balconied loft space (above the performance space). This space will serve as a green room for performers and event staff during the performances. Since the space has a balcony that overlooks the Meeting Room performance space, it is important to maintain silence as it will be heard below during the performances.
Please note that the loft is not currently ADA accessible. An alternate changing space will be provided for any performers that require ADA accessible spaces.
Food and beverages are permitted in the loft. The space may also be used for storage of personal items during the event; however, SPNYC and Judson Memorial Church are not responsible for any lost or stolen items during the event.
The loft may be accessed via a grand stairwell extending from the main entrance at 55 Washington Square South, as well as a secondary staircase located within the Meeting Room near the tech table. This interior staircase is not for public use under any circumstances, and stanchions are provided to prevent audience access.
When the loft is being used as a green room or performer staging area, artists and event staff may use the staircase to access the stage or performance space, making it a convenient entrance for performers.
